When the Outlook PST file approaches the set maximum PST file size limit set by the administrator, it fails to add/store more data. By default, Personal Folders (.pst) and offline Outlook Data File (.ost) files are in Unicode format in Microsoft Outlook 2010 and Outlook 2013.

  • Outlook 2010, Outlook 2013, and Outlook 2016 has file size limit up to 50 GB.
  • Outlook 2002 and prior versions of Outlook allow you to store data only up to 2 GB.

    Once the set PST file size limit reaches or exceeds, no more data can be saved in the PST file. Outlook 2002 and earlier versions use American National Standards Institute (ANSI) format, whereas later versions of Outlook employ the UNICODE format.Īlong with different formats, Microsoft has also set different Outlook. These formats are of two types - ANSI and UNICODE. Each version of Outlook has a different format.
